BUSINESS NEWS

  • Two longtime downtown Ann Arbor businesses will close by year's end due to rising costs and fewer visitors. Downtown Home and Garden will close Christmas Eve—Kilwins Ann Arbor is set to shut its doors on December 31.  ClickOnDetroit.com
  • Kilwins Chocolate Shoppe at 107 E. Liberty St. in downtown Ann Arbor is closing soon—official plans have not been shared.  MLive

EDUCATION NEWS

  • Amina Allen, a trailblazing educator at Saline Alternative High School and Ann Arbor schools, died on August 2 after a short illness. Her daughter Savannah Allen and local school leaders remembered her as a dedicated leader who built herself up and supported students despite many challenges.  MLive

GOVERNMENT NEWS

  • Ann Arbor city council approved a resolution on Aug 7 to review marijuana rules after dispensary owner Raymond Somich said his Kings High store lost nearly one million dollars due to a rule that requires dispensaries to be 1,000 feet from K–12 schools — the Planning Commission will hold a public hearing and may recommend a temporary reduction in the distance to help new stores open — as part of the review. This action follows complaints that outdated regulations are hindering business operations.  MLive

HEALTH NEWS

  • Michigan Medicine sent postcards without envelopes that revealed sensitive health details on June 27—affecting over 1,000 patients. The research team stopped mailings and will review safeguards to better protect patient privacy.  MLive
